An individual development plan, or IDP, is an action plan designed to improve the knowledge and abilities of an individual. The Individual Learning Monitoring Plan, on the other hand, is a more specific tool which shall be used by teachers and learning facilitators for learners who lag behind as shown by the results of their formative and summative assessments. With a PGP, teachers, administrators, paraeducators, and ESAs set their own goals, align them to certification standards, design an action plan, and collect evidence documenting growth towards achieving their goals.
